Promotional Guidelines

Affiliates must follow strict marketing guidelines when promoting Lucky Seven Casino. All advertising materials, including banners, landing pages, and written content, must be approved in advance by the casino’s compliance team. Promotions must not target minors, misrepresent the casino’s offerings, or make unsubstantiated claims. In Australia, all gambling advertising must comply with the Interactive Gambling Act 2001 (Cth), state-based regulations, and relevant codes of practice. Affiliates are prohibited from using unsolicited electronic communications (spam) or misleading advertising tactics.

Payment Terms and Taxation

Commission payments are processed monthly, provided the affiliate meets the minimum threshold specified in the agreement. Affiliates must supply valid payment details and, if required by law, an Australian Business Number (ABN) or Tax File Number (TFN). All commissions are reported for tax purposes, and affiliates are responsible for declaring and remitting any taxes due. Lucky Seven Casino may withhold payment in the event of compliance concerns or unresolved disputes regarding referred player activity.
